KidsPeace Childrens Hospital PROGRAM AND STAFF DEVELOPMENT SUPERVISOR NC in VARINA, North Carolina
The Program and Staff Development Supervisor is responsible for the orientation, training, and development of KidsPeace associates in all programs and departments. The Program and Development Supervisor serves as a partner with program/department leadership in mentoring and development of new and veteran staff as well as participates in the implementation and auditing of program design within KidsPeace Programs.
